Abstract
It is important for automatic fingerprint identification system to detect singularities of fingerprint images accurately and reliably. This paper proposes an improved method for singularity detection of fingerprint images. First, a fingerprint image is divided into non-overlapping blocks with the same size, the column which the core belongs to is acquired by detecting the horizontal part of the ridge, and then the row which the core belongs to is got. Also, the column and the row, which the delta belongs to, are acquired according to those acute variable ridge directions of left and right parts of the delta. Then, singularities are detected with Poincare index within the block image which the column and the row belong to. If no singularity is detected in the block image, search area is expanded to detect. At worst, the whole image is searched. Experimental results indicate that the improved method is effective and, even to low quality image, it still can detect the singularities reliably.
